Zimbabwe: 10 Drown in Masvingo

Ten people have drowned in Masvingo during the past month while trying to cross flooded rivers.

Police in the province have since warned people to avoid crossing flooded rivers, as heavy rains have left many rivers busting to their seams.

Masvingo police spokesperson Inspector Peter Zhanero confirmed the deaths.

Insp Zhanero said most of the drownings were recorded in Chiredzi, Gutu and Bikita.

"Over the past 30 days 10 people drowned in various rivers across the province and most of the drownings were recorded in Chiredzi, Gutu and Bikita.

"In most cases the people who drowned were trying to cross flooded rivers while others drowned while swimming," said Inspector Zhanero.

He said most of the people who drowned were young people and warned people against crossing flooded rivers, especially at this time when the rain season has started.
